Mission: TO PROTECT HEALTH AND ENVIRONMENT FROM TOXICS
Programs: Alaska rural environmental justice program: the goal is to eliminate environmental contaminants that affect the waters, traditional foods, health, and cultures of the indigenous peoples of alaska.
environmental health policy and social change program: the goal is to motivate a broad range of public support to instigate local, national, and international policies to protect the health of people, wildlife, and the environment from environmental contaminants.
environmental health education program: to inform physicians, nurses, teachers, scientists, environmentalists, and other professionals as well as the general public about the link between pollutants and human health and the environment.
